Persistent Pool Leaks

Is your pool losing water faster than evaporation can explain? You might be dealing with a hidden leak—common in older pools exposed to Vernon’s freeze-thaw cycles. Pool leak detection is essential to locate the source, whether it’s in plumbing, the shell, or hydrostatic pressure relief systems. Ignoring it leads to wasted water, rising bills, and potential damage to your pool deck restoration or surrounding landscape.

Regional Factors Affecting Pool Longevity

Cold-Weather Pool Cracking

Vernon's cold winters bring repeated freeze-thaw cycles that test even the most durable pools. Water trapped in small cracks expands when frozen, causing spalling, tile lift, and structural stress—especially in concrete pool repair zones. Proper winterization services are non-negotiable; skipping them risks costly emergency pool repair come spring.

Regional Water Quality Challenges

The Okanagan’s hard water introduces high levels of calcium and minerals, leading to scaling Get More Info on heaters, cloudy water, and degraded plaster. Regular waterline tile cleaning and balanced chemistry are vital to prevent damage. A certified pool technician can recommend treatments tailored to Vernon BC pool services needs, including specialized filtration or chelating agents.

Ignoring water chemistry accelerates wear and shortens the life of your pool renovation investment.
